Why Veterans Benefit from In-Home Support
Veterans often have unique care needs shaped by service history, aging, or chronic conditions. In-home care offers the personalized support that helps them stay comfortable and confident at home.
Common reasons veterans begin care include:
Declining mobility
Increased fall risk
Challenges with personal hygiene
Memory concerns, including dementia
Loneliness or isolation
Short-term recovery after hospitalization

How Aid & Attendance Fits In
Many North Shore families don't realize that VA Pension with Aid & Attendance may help offset the cost of care.
Aid & Attendance is often used to help with:
Personal care & daily activities
Supervision for safety
Meal preparation & household tasks
Transportation assistance
Respite support for family caregivers
Comfort Angels is a private-pay agency.
Families pay us directly and may use VA benefits as part of their budget. We can provide detailed care documentation and refer families to VA-accredited support.
